Abstract:
This paper is a report on the findings from the research and development of STEAMification model in flipped classroom learning environment to enhance creative thinking and creative innovation. The purposes of this study are: 1) to develop the model; 2) to study the developed model. Results exhibited that: 1) the model consists of 6 components, 2) the students who had studied through STEAMification had higher creativity (Mean = 14.53, S.D. = 0.94) than the students who studied through normal model (Mean = 12.90, S.D. = 1.91), 3) the students who had studied through model had higher quality of creative innovation (Mean = 14.86, S.D. = 1.62) than the students who studied through normal model (Mean = 12.90, S.D. = 1.91).
